The NL17SZ00DFT2 is a high-performance triple input NAND gate integrated circuit from ON Semiconductor, designed to deliver efficient and reliable logic operations. This device is part of ON Semiconductor's extensive range of logic gates, which are known for their low power consumption and compact design.
Key Features
- Operating Voltage: The NL17SZ00DFT2 operates at a voltage range of 1.65V to 5.5V, making it suitable for a variety of low-voltage applications as well as compatibility with TTL levels.
- High-Speed Operation: With a typical propagation delay time of only 4.5ns at a 5V supply voltage, this device is optimized for high-speed logic operations.
- Low Power Consumption: It is designed for low power consumption, with a typical quiescent current of only 1µA, helping to extend battery life in portable applications.
- SOT-353 Package: The NL17SZ00DFT2 comes in a compact SOT-353 package, which is ideal for space-constrained applications.
